Congress President Election Results 2022 LIVE Updates: Kharge's win shows Sonia Gandhi last word in party, says Cong leader Ashwani Kumar
Mallikarjun Kharge has been elected new Congress president. The counting for the election held on october 17 was conducted today. Congress' central election authority chairman Madhusudan Mistry announced after the counting of votes that of the 9,385 votes polled in the Congress president poll, Kharge got 7,897 votes and Shashi Tharoor 1,072 votes, while 416 votes were declared invalid. The Congress has claimed that its internal democracy has no parallel in any other party and it is the only one to have a central election authority for organisational polls.
05:40 (IST) Oct 19
The sealed ballot boxes will be opened before the candidates' agents and the votes will be mixed repeatedly as they are added from various boxes. This is to ensure that neither candidate will be able to tell who voted for them and from which state.
05:40 (IST) Oct 19
The process of bringing all the ballot boxes from the 68 polling booths set up across the country by the party will be completed by Tuesday evening. The sealed boxes will be kept in a "strong room" at the party HQ till the time of counting.
